Filing History

IRS 990 filing history for The Friends Of The Clarksville Montgomery County Public Library showing financial trends over 12 years of public records:

Over 12 years of IRS 990 filings (2013–2024), The Friends Of The Clarksville Montgomery County Public Library's revenue has grown by 32.8%, moving from $111K to $148K. Total assets increased by 105.8% over the same period, from $67K to $138K. Total functional expenses rose by 65.1%, from $70K to $115K. In its most recent filing year (2024), The Friends Of The Clarksville Montgomery County Public Library reported a surplus of $33K, with revenue exceeding expenses.

Data Sources and Methodology

This transparency report for The Friends Of The Clarksville Montgomery County Public Library is generated by NonprofitSpending's AI analysis engine. The data is sourced from publicly available IRS 990 filings accessed through the ProPublica Nonprofit Explorer API and IRS electronic filing records. The Mission Score, spending breakdown, and other analytical insights are produced by artificial intelligence and should be used as one of multiple factors when evaluating a nonprofit organization.

IRS 990 forms are annual information returns that most tax-exempt organizations must file with the IRS. These forms provide detailed financial information including revenue, expenses, assets, liabilities, and compensation of officers.
